How Long Should a Professional Paint Job Last?

One of the best things about hiring a professional painting company is the longevity of the results. But how long should you expect that fresh paint to last? Here's what affects the lifespan and what you can do to maximize it.

Interior Paint: 5-10 Years A professional interior paint job typically lasts 5 to 10 years, depending on the room. High-traffic areas like hallways and kitchens may show wear sooner, while bedrooms and formal rooms can go a decade or more. Using quality paint and proper preparation are the biggest factors.

Exterior Paint: 5-7 Years In the San Jose area's climate, exterior paint faces UV exposure, rain and moisture, and occasional rain. A professional job with premium paint should last 5 to 7 years. Proper surface prep -- including power washing, scraping, and priming -- is what makes the difference between 3 years and 7.

Factors That Affect Longevity - Paint quality: Premium paints contain more pigment and resin, resulting in better coverage and durability - Surface preparation: Properly prepped surfaces hold paint significantly longer - Climate exposure: South and west-facing walls fade faster due to sun exposure - Color choice: Darker colors fade faster than lighter ones on exteriors - Moisture: Bathrooms, kitchens, and coastal homes face more moisture challenges

Signs It's Time to Repaint - Visible fading or discoloration - Peeling, cracking, or bubbling - Chalky residue when you touch the surface - Stains that won't wash off - You simply want a fresh look

Extending Your Paint's Life - Address moisture issues promptly - Clean walls gently with a damp cloth annually - Touch up chips and scratches as they appear - Maintain caulking around windows and doors - Keep landscaping trimmed away from painted surfaces
